Engage Your Elected Officials

Wales is a small country which means it is fairly easy to engage directly with your elected officials.

Ask for a Meeting

All level of government officials tend to make time for one-on-one conversations with the public. Just email them and ask for a meeting.

For the best meeting:

  • Prepare how you want to present your issue
  • Bring relevant information
  • Be respectful and concise
  • Actively listen to their feedback. There may be considerations that you don’t know about and listening to your elected officials is a great way to learn how things work and how you can help the system make the best decision for you
  • Follow up with a thank you note

Write to your officials

Email: Reach out to Elin Jones (elin.jones@senedd.wales), Ben Lake (Ben.lake.mp@parliament.uk), Ceredigion County Councillors via this https://council.ceredigion.gov.uk/mgCommitteeMailingList.aspx?ID=0&LLL=0 , and Aberystwyth Town Council at council@aberystwyth.gov.uk .

Tips for a good letter:

  • Keep it brief—1 page or less
  • Be respectful—include relevant facts
  • Name a call to action—be clear in what you are asking them to do
  • End with thanks—ask for a reply and thank them for their time

Attend Public Meetings

It’s easy to attend meetings for your local government. You don’t even have to leave your sofa!

To attend Ceredigion County Council committee meetings online, email democracy@ceredigion.gov.uk . You can find the committees here: https://council.ceredigion.gov.uk/mgListCommittees.aspx?bcr=1 .

Aberystwyth Town Council Meetings are Mondays at 6:30 at Neuadd Gwenfrewi Queen’s Road Aberystwyth SY23 2HS​
